Pass in your base branch as an argument to rebase2base, which will determine the number of commits since your base branch, and then run git rebase -i … WebJun 1, 2024 · Simply append to the end of the command the name of the source branch and then the name of the branch to rebase. To rebase develop to master the command is as follows: git rebase master develop. WebAug 19, 2014 · 16. git pull --rebase may hide a history rewriting from a collaborator git push --force. I recommend to use git pull --rebase only if you know you forgot to push your commits before someone else does the same. If you did not commit anything, but your working space is not clean, just git stash before to git pull.

Step 1: Keep going git rebase --continue. Step 2: fix CONFLICTS then git add . Back to step 1, now if it says no changes .. then run git rebase --skip and go back to step 1. If you just want to quit rebase run git rebase --abort.
